HRC Employer Quick Report for Sears Holding CorpI was chatting with Shannon Garcia of Trans Youth Family Allies on the Saturday night after Black Friday, and let her know I did some shopping online at Lands' End. Shannon was telling me they it was well know that Lands' End was a company that were not supportive of their LGBT workers. Well, I never heard that, so I looked up the company last night.

And, as some my already know, Lands' End was bought out by Sears (specifically, Sears Holding Corp.) a few years ago. Whatever the policies were for Lands' End when it was a stand alone company aren't currently in play. Does that mean that the Lands' End division of Sears currently follows Sears polices? Well, I don't know -- I didn't find anything online when I looked.
